Hi there, I'm new to this forum. I just want to know will its right fin grow back?

Yeah, i think it only takes 2-3 weeks with proper maintenance of water condition. My bichirs fins were severely torn by my turtle before, but soon they fully-recovered pretty well. Also, one of my bichirs jumped into divided part of aquarium, got sucked and stuck in the output pipe. He remains there for a while until i noticed and removed him. A big red mark appeared in his body (from the strong suction), i thought maybe internal skin bleeding or so. I was surprised that only in 2-3 days the mark had completely gone. U'd be surprised at how hardy the fish is. Dont worry just do ur part, and let the fish recovers.
